Changeset 5474 in orxonox.OLD for trunk/src/lib/event/key_names.cc
- Timestamp:
- Nov 3, 2005, 2:13:48 PM (19 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/lib/event/key_names.cc
r4780 r5474 15 15 16 16 #include "key_names.h" 17 #include "event_def.h" 17 18 18 19 #include "stdincl.h" … … 24 25 int buttonnameToSDLB(const char* name) 25 26 { 26 if( !strcmp (name, "BUTTON_LEFT")) return SDL_BUTTON_LEFT; 27 if( !strcmp (name, "BUTTON_LEFT")) 28 return EV_MOUSE_BUTTON_LEFT; 27 29 if( !strcmp (name, "BUTTON_MIDDLE")) return SDL_BUTTON_MIDDLE; 28 30 if( !strcmp (name, "BUTTON_RIGHT")) return SDL_BUTTON_RIGHT; … … 32 34 } 33 35 34 c har* SDLBToButtonname( int button)36 const char* SDLBToButtonname( int button) 35 37 { 36 if( button == SDL_BUTTON_LEFT) return "BUTTON_LEFT";38 if( button == EV_MOUSE_BUTTON_LEFT) return "BUTTON_LEFT"; 37 39 if( button == SDL_BUTTON_MIDDLE) return "BUTTON_MIDDLE"; 38 40 if( button == SDL_BUTTON_RIGHT) return "BUTTON_RIGHT"; … … 180 182 } 181 183 182 c har* SDLKToKeyname( int key)184 const char* SDLKToKeyname( int key) 183 185 { 184 186 if( key == SDLK_BACKSPACE) return "BACKSPACE";
Note: See TracChangeset
for help on using the changeset viewer.